Summary:

The Taylorville Senior High School is the sole high school serving the Taylorville CUSD 3 school district in Illinois. The school has faced some challenges in recent years, with its statewide ranking declining from 239th out of 699 Illinois high schools in 2022-2023 to 356th out of 698 in 2024-2025. This suggests the school's performance may be lagging compared to other high schools in the state.

Taylorville Senior High School's proficiency rates on standardized tests, such as the ACT and PreACT Secure, are consistently lower than the state averages, indicating the school may need to focus on improving academic outcomes for its students. Additionally, the school's chronic absenteeism rate of 25.4% for 2024-2025 is significantly higher than the state average, which could be a contributing factor to the school's lower academic performance and may require targeted interventions.

Despite the school's relatively high per-student spending and lower student-teacher ratio, its academic performance still lags behind the state average. This suggests that factors beyond just funding and resources may be influencing the school's outcomes, such as curriculum, teaching quality, or other school-level factors. Overall, the data indicates that Taylorville Senior High School is facing some challenges and may benefit from a closer examination of its instructional practices, attendance policies, and resource allocation to identify areas for improvement and better support student success.
